    Emiliano Martínez Sets Saves Record in World Cup Final

    In a stunning performance in the World Cup final, Argentina goalkeeper Emiliano Martínez has also made history. Late in regulation against Spain, Martínez broke the saves record in a World Cup final with his ninth save of the match.

    Beyond near-single-handedly sending the game to extra time, Martínez has now denied Spain 11 times and counting.

    Argentina’s offense has struggled significantly, failing to record a shot in the first 105-plus minutes of play even as Spain turned up the pressure. But Martínez was there to continue to stave off La Roja’s long-awaited goal and hold the clean sheet at any costs.

    Eventually, though, the dam broke. Martínez allowed one goal in the first half of extra time, though it was later called back due to a foul in the box. He then allowed another at the start of the second extra time period, with Ferran Torres giving Spain a 1-0 lead.
